dapparse.c#16 | static OCtype octypefor(Object etype); |
#42 | Object |
#43 | dap_datasetbody(DAPparsestate* state, Object name, Object decls) |
#56 | return (Object)NULL; |
#67 | Object |
#68 | dap_attributebody(DAPparsestate* state, Object attrlist) |
#91 | Object code, Object msg, Object ptype, Object prog) |
#115 | Object |
#116 | dap_declarations(DAPparsestate* state, Object decls, Object decl) |
#126 | Object |
#127 | dap_arraydecls(DAPparsestate* state, Object arraydecls, Object arraydecl) |
#137 | Object |
#138 | dap_arraydecl(DAPparsestate* state, Object name, Object size) |
#154 | Object |
#155 | dap_attrlist(DAPparsestate* state, Object attrlist, Object attrtuple) |
#168 | Object |
#169 | dap_attrvalue(DAPparsestate* state, Object valuelist, Object value, Object etype) |
#179 | Object |
#180 | dap_attribute(DAPparsestate* state, Object name, Object values, Object etype) |
#189 | Object |
#190 | dap_attrset(DAPparsestate* state, Object name, Object attributes) |
#263 | Object |
#264 | dap_makebase(DAPparsestate* state, Object name, Object etype, Object dimensions) |
#273 | Object |
#274 | dap_makestructure(DAPparsestate* state, Object name, Object dimensions, Object fields) |
#282 | return (Object)NULL; |
#291 | Object |
#292 | dap_makesequence(DAPparsestate* state, Object name, Object members) |
#299 | return (Object)NULL; |
#307 | Object |
#308 | dap_makegrid(DAPparsestate* state, Object name, Object arraydecl, Object mapdecls) |
#317 | return (Object)NULL; |
#426 | octypefor(Object etype) |
dapparselex.h#13 | typedef void* Object; |
#15 | #define YYSTYPE Object |
#58 | extern Object dap_datasetbody(DAPparsestate*,Object decls, Object name); |
#59 | extern Object dap_declarations(DAPparsestate*,Object decls, Object decl); |
#60 | extern Object dap_arraydecls(DAPparsestate*,Object arraydecls, Object arraydecl); |
#61 | extern Object dap_arraydecl(DAPparsestate*,Object name, Object size); |
#64 | extern Object dap_attributebody(DAPparsestate*,Object attrlist); |
#65 | extern Object dap_attrlist(DAPparsestate*,Object attrlist, Object attrtuple); |
#66 | extern Object dap_attribute(DAPparsestate*,Object name, Object value, Object etype); |
#67 | extern Object dap_attrset(DAPparsestate*,Object name, Object attributes); |
#68 | extern Object dap_attrvalue(DAPparsestate*,Object valuelist, Object value, Object etype); |
#70 | extern Object dap_makebase(DAPparsestate*,Object name, Object etype, Object dimensions); |
#71 | extern Object dap_makestructure(DAPparsestate*,Object name, Object dimensions, Object fields); |
#72 | extern Object dap_makesequence(DAPparsestate*,Object name, Object members); |
#73 | extern Object dap_makegrid(DAPparsestate*,Object name, Object arraydecl, Object mapdecls); |
#75 | extern void dap_errorbody(DAPparsestate*, Object, Object, Object, Object); |
dapy.c#1482 | {(yyval)=(Object)SCAN_BYTE;} |
#1488 | {(yyval)=(Object)SCAN_INT16;} |
#1494 | {(yyval)=(Object)SCAN_UINT16;} |
#1500 | {(yyval)=(Object)SCAN_INT32;} |
#1506 | {(yyval)=(Object)SCAN_UINT32;} |
#1512 | {(yyval)=(Object)SCAN_FLOAT32;} |
#1518 | {(yyval)=(Object)SCAN_FLOAT64;} |
#1524 | {(yyval)=(Object)SCAN_URL;} |
#1530 | {(yyval)=(Object)SCAN_STRING;} |
#1620 | {(yyval)=dap_attribute(parsestate,(yyvsp[-2]),(yyvsp[-1]),(Object)SCAN_BYTE);} |
#1626 | {(yyval)=dap_attribute(parsestate,(yyvsp[-2]),(yyvsp[-1]),(Object)SCAN_INT16);} |
#1632 | {(yyval)=dap_attribute(parsestate,(yyvsp[-2]),(yyvsp[-1]),(Object)SCAN_UINT16);} |
#1638 | {(yyval)=dap_attribute(parsestate,(yyvsp[-2]),(yyvsp[-1]),(Object)SCAN_INT32);} |
#1644 | {(yyval)=dap_attribute(parsestate,(yyvsp[-2]),(yyvsp[-1]),(Object)SCAN_UINT32);} |
#1650 | {(yyval)=dap_attribute(parsestate,(yyvsp[-2]),(yyvsp[-1]),(Object)SCAN_FLOAT32);} |
#1656 | {(yyval)=dap_attribute(parsestate,(yyvsp[-2]),(yyvsp[-1]),(Object)SCAN_FLOAT64);} |
#1662 | {(yyval)=dap_attribute(parsestate,(yyvsp[-2]),(yyvsp[-1]),(Object)SCAN_STRING);} |
#1668 | {(yyval)=dap_attribute(parsestate,(yyvsp[-2]),(yyvsp[-1]),(Object)SCAN_URL);} |
#1686 | {(yyval)=dap_attrvalue(parsestate,null,(yyvsp[0]),(Object)SCAN_BYTE);} |
#1692 | {(yyval)=dap_attrvalue(parsestate,(yyvsp[-2]),(yyvsp[0]),(Object)SCAN_BYTE);} |
#1698 | {(yyval)=dap_attrvalue(parsestate,null,(yyvsp[0]),(Object)SCAN_INT16);} |
#1704 | {(yyval)=dap_attrvalue(parsestate,(yyvsp[-2]),(yyvsp[0]),(Object)SCAN_INT16);} |
#1710 | {(yyval)=dap_attrvalue(parsestate,null,(yyvsp[0]),(Object)SCAN_UINT16);} |
#1716 | {(yyval)=dap_attrvalue(parsestate,(yyvsp[-2]),(yyvsp[0]),(Object)SCAN_UINT16);} |
#1722 | {(yyval)=dap_attrvalue(parsestate,null,(yyvsp[0]),(Object)SCAN_INT32);} |
#1728 | {(yyval)=dap_attrvalue(parsestate,(yyvsp[-2]),(yyvsp[0]),(Object)SCAN_INT32);} |
#1734 | {(yyval)=dap_attrvalue(parsestate,null,(yyvsp[0]),(Object)SCAN_UINT32);} |
#1740 | {(yyval)=dap_attrvalue(parsestate,(yyvsp[-2]),(yyvsp[0]),(Object)SCAN_UINT32);} |
#1746 | {(yyval)=dap_attrvalue(parsestate,null,(yyvsp[0]),(Object)SCAN_FLOAT32);} |
#1752 | {(yyval)=dap_attrvalue(parsestate,(yyvsp[-2]),(yyvsp[0]),(Object)SCAN_FLOAT32);} |
#1758 | {(yyval)=dap_attrvalue(parsestate,null,(yyvsp[0]),(Object)SCAN_FLOAT64);} |
#1764 | {(yyval)=dap_attrvalue(parsestate,(yyvsp[-2]),(yyvsp[0]),(Object)SCAN_FLOAT64);} |
#1770 | {(yyval)=dap_attrvalue(parsestate,null,(yyvsp[0]),(Object)SCAN_STRING);} |
#1776 | {(yyval)=dap_attrvalue(parsestate,(yyvsp[-2]),(yyvsp[0]),(Object)SCAN_STRING);} |
#1782 | {(yyval)=dap_attrvalue(parsestate,null,(yyvsp[0]),(Object)SCAN_URL);} |
#1788 | {(yyval)=dap_attrvalue(parsestate,(yyvsp[-2]),(yyvsp[0]),(Object)SCAN_URL);} |
dceparse.c#23 | static Object collectlist(Object list0, Object decl); |
#26 | projections(DCEparsestate* state, Object list0) |
#40 | selections(DCEparsestate* state, Object list0) |
#54 | Object |
#55 | projectionlist(DCEparsestate* state, Object list0, Object decl) |
#60 | Object |
#61 | projection(DCEparsestate* state, Object varorfcn) |
#77 | Object |
#78 | segmentlist(DCEparsestate* state, Object var0, Object decl) |
#91 | Object |
#92 | segment(DCEparsestate* state, Object name, Object slices0) |
#117 | Object |
#118 | rangelist(DCEparsestate* state, Object list0, Object decl) |
#123 | Object |
#124 | range(DCEparsestate* state, Object sfirst, Object sstride, Object slast) |
#157 | Object |
#158 | range1(DCEparsestate* state, Object rangenumber) |
#168 | Object |
#169 | clauselist(DCEparsestate* state, Object list0, Object decl) |
#174 | Object |
#176 | Object lhs, Object relop0, Object values) |
#189 | Object |
#190 | indexpath(DCEparsestate* state, Object list0, Object index) |
#195 | Object |
#196 | array_indices(DCEparsestate* state, Object list0, Object indexno) |
#217 | Object |
#218 | indexer(DCEparsestate* state, Object name, Object indices) |
#233 | Object |
#234 | function(DCEparsestate* state, Object fcnname, Object args) |
#242 | Object |
#243 | arg_list(DCEparsestate* state, Object list0, Object decl) |
#249 | Object |
#250 | value_list(DCEparsestate* state, Object list0, Object decl) |
#255 | Object |
#256 | value(DCEparsestate* state, Object val) |
#270 | Object |
#271 | var(DCEparsestate* state, Object indexpath) |
#278 | Object |
#279 | constant(DCEparsestate* state, Object val, int tag) |
#305 | static Object |
#306 | collectlist(Object list0, Object decl) |
#314 | Object |
#317 | return (Object) tag; |
#392 | Object |
#393 | debugobject(Object o) |
dceparselex.h#25 | typedef void* Object; |
#27 | #define YYSTYPE Object |
#63 | extern void projections(DCEparsestate* state, Object list0); |
#64 | extern void selections(DCEparsestate* state, Object list0); |
#65 | extern Object projectionlist(DCEparsestate* state, Object list0, Object decl); |
#66 | extern Object projection(DCEparsestate* state, Object segmentlist); |
#67 | extern Object segmentlist(DCEparsestate* state, Object list0, Object decl); |
#68 | extern Object segment(DCEparsestate* state, Object name, Object slices0); |
#69 | extern Object array_indices(DCEparsestate* state, Object list0, Object decl); |
#70 | extern Object range(DCEparsestate* state, Object, Object, Object); |
#71 | extern Object selectionlist(DCEparsestate* state, Object list0, Object decl); |
#72 | extern Object sel_clause(DCEparsestate* state, int selcase, Object path0, Object relop0, Object values); |
#73 | extern Object selectionpath(DCEparsestate* state, Object list0, Object text); |
#74 | extern Object arrayelement(DCEparsestate* state, Object name, Object index); |
#75 | extern Object function(DCEparsestate* state, Object fcnname, Object args); |
#76 | extern Object arg_list(DCEparsestate* state, Object list0, Object decl); |
#77 | extern Object value_list(DCEparsestate* state, Object list0, Object decl); |
#78 | extern Object value(DCEparsestate* state, Object value); |
#79 | extern Object makeselectiontag(CEsort); |
#80 | extern Object indexer(DCEparsestate* state, Object name, Object indices); |
#81 | extern Object indexpath(DCEparsestate* state, Object list0, Object index); |
#82 | extern Object var(DCEparsestate* state, Object indexpath); |
#83 | extern Object constant(DCEparsestate* state, Object val, int tag); |
#84 | extern Object clauselist(DCEparsestate* state, Object list0, Object decl); |
#85 | extern Object range1(DCEparsestate* state, Object rangenumber); |
#86 | extern Object rangelist(DCEparsestate* state, Object list0, Object decl); |
#96 | extern Object debugobject(Object); |
dcetab.c#1290 | {(yyval)=projectionlist(parsestate,(Object)null,(yyvsp[0]));} |
HyperKWIC - Version 7.20DA executed at 11:37 on 27 Oct 2017 | Polyhedron Solutions - INTERNAL USE | COMMERCIAL (Any O/S) SN 4AKIed